I purchased the 5000 King Size with the single wireless remote control close to two years ago, to replace the water bed I had owned for over 10 years. After the sticker shock had worn off for what amounts to pretty much two air mattresses. I can say without a doubt that this is the best bed I've ever slept on. The bed just flat out works.

It will take you several nights to get used to it at least that's what happened to me. But once you get your number dialed in you won't believe how much of a difference this bed makes. Then down the road if you want a firmer or softer mattress just hit the button on the remote.

I have the 5000 Extended King. We love it. There is somewhat of a "sticker shock". Ask for last years model. Mine was $1700 with dual controls.

Don't be suprised when it shows up and it's all plastic, for the most part. I was pretty disappointed that I spent that much money for what looks like to be very little.

On a good note, it is a great bed.
